The Evolution of Taylor Swift's Merch


When Taylor Swift first entered the music scene in the mid-2000s, her merchandise was relatively simple, focused mainly on t-shirts, posters, and other typical band merch. As her career progressed, however, so did the complexity and variety of her merchandise. With each album release, Swift’s merchandise became more curated, creating a cohesive experience that reflected the themes and aesthetics of the music itself.





  • Early Years: Country Charm In the early days of Taylor Swift’s career, during the release of her self-titled debut album (2006) and her follow-up "Fearless" (2008), her merchandise was simple, often featuring her name, a basic logo, or album art. The items were straightforward: t-shirts, keychains, and posters, appealing to the young, country music audience who were discovering her at the time.




  • The Red Era: The Start of a Shift When "Red" was released in 2012, Taylor began experimenting with a more mature, pop-influenced style. This shift was reflected in her merchandise, which became more sophisticated and included a wider range of items, such as scarves, accessories, and even vinyl records. The "Red" tour merch became iconic for its combination of bold typography, vintage-inspired designs, and nods to the album's color theme. Taylor also started embracing more exclusive, limited-edition merchandise, which appealed to die-hard fans.




  • 1989: Full Pop Overhaul The release of "1989" in 2014 marked a monumental shift in Taylor’s musical identity, and her merchandise evolved accordingly. The "1989" merch line included unique items such as graphic t-shirts with lyrics from the album, as well as more fashionable pieces like denim jackets and oversized sweatshirts. Fans were able to buy not just album-related items but also pieces that could fit into everyday fashion. Taylor’s attention to detail in the design of her merchandise showed her commitment to offering something for every type of fan, whether they were looking for concert memorabilia or fashion-forward clothing.




  • Reputation: Darker, Edgier Merchandise With the release of "Reputation" in 2017, Taylor embraced a darker, more rebellious aesthetic both in her music and in her merchandise. The "Reputation" merch featured bold, graphic designs, including snake motifs, dark colors, and edgy logos. Fans were drawn to the more intense and mysterious imagery, which perfectly reflected the album’s themes of vengeance, self-discovery, and empowerment. The merch items were not only a reflection of Taylor's journey but also a way for fans to embody that same sense of empowerment and defiance.




  • Lover and Folklore: Whimsical to Rustic Taylor Swift’s merchandise from the "Lover" (2019) and "Folklore" (2020) albums introduced a more whimsical and rustic aesthetic. The "Lover" collection, with its pastel color palette, embraced soft, romantic imagery, and included items like heart-shaped sunglasses, light-up signs, and cozy sweatshirts adorned with album quotes. In contrast, "Folklore" merch had a more rustic and vintage vibe, with earthy tones and nature-inspired designs that reflected the introspective, folk-inspired sound of the album.




  • Evermore and Midnights: Continuing the Legacy As Taylor Swift continued to release albums like "Evermore" (2020) and "Midnights" (2022), her merch continued to evolve with unique and limited-edition items for each album cycle. "Evermore" merch leaned into cozy, nostalgic vibes, while "Midnights" showcased the evolution of Swift’s aesthetic, mixing glittering, dreamy visuals with deeper, more introspective motifs.




Popular Merchandise Items


Taylor Swift's merchandise offers something for every type of fan, whether they're looking for memorabilia to remember a concert or pieces to integrate into their everyday lives. Some of the most popular and iconic items in her merch collection include:





  1. T-Shirts and Hoodies T-shirts and hoodies are staples in Taylor Swift’s merchandise collection. Each album cycle brings unique designs and artwork related to that particular era. Fans eagerly await new designs, which often include lyrics from the album or graphics inspired by her music. For example, the "Fearless" era featured classic, country-inspired tees, while the "1989" era had more graphic, urban designs.




  2. Vinyl Records For fans who appreciate the physicality of music, Taylor Swift’s vinyl releases have been highly sought after. Many albums, including "Red," "1989," and "Lover," have been available on vinyl, with exclusive versions often featuring limited-edition covers, colors, or bonus tracks. These records provide a nostalgic connection to her music and are a way for fans to celebrate her catalog.




  3. Accessories From scarves to jewelry and even blankets, Taylor’s accessories collection is expansive. Many of these items are carefully curated to match the theme of her albums. For example, the "1989" era featured oversized sunglasses and chic accessories, while "Lover" had heart-shaped earrings and delicate, pastel-colored items.




  4. Concert Merch As with many artists, concert merch is often the most popular and highly anticipated of all Taylor Swift’s collections. Her tours are known for offering exclusive, one-of-a-kind items that can only be purchased at the show. Fans line up for these items, knowing they’ll be able to get their hands on limited-edition pieces tied to specific dates or locations. This includes everything from tour programs to exclusive t-shirts and concert posters.




  5. Limited-Edition and Special-Release Items One of the reasons Taylor Swift’s merch is so popular is the release of special, limited-edition items. These items often come with exclusive packaging or designs and are released as part of a special event, album drop, or tour. For example, the "Red (Taylor's Version)" release in 2021 included exclusive merchandise celebrating her re-recorded version of the album, such as red-themed t-shirts and vinyl.
